raeudigerRaeffi/turbular
A MCP server allowing LLM agents to easily connect and retrieve data from any database
Supports seven database types (PostgreSQL, MySQL, SQLite, BigQuery, Oracle, MS SQL, Redshift) through pluggable connectors extending a BaseDBConnector interface. Automatically normalizes database schemas to LLM-compatible naming conventions and transforms generated queries back to their original form, while optimizing query execution before running. Built on FastAPI with Docker deployment, it exposes REST endpoints for schema retrieval, query execution, and file uploads (BigQuery keys, SQLite files).
No commits in the last 6 months.
Stars
99
Forks
13
Language
Python
License
—
Category
Last pushed
Aug 01, 2025
Commits (30d)
0
Get this data via API
curl "https://pt-edge.onrender.com/api/v1/quality/mcp/raeudigerRaeffi/turbular"
Open to everyone — 100 requests/day, no key needed. Get a free key for 1,000/day.
Higher-rated alternatives
bytebase/dbhub
Zero-dependency, token-efficient database MCP server for Postgres, MySQL, SQL Server, MariaDB, SQLite.
HenkDz/postgresql-mcp-server
A Powerful PostgreSQL MCP server with 14 consolidated database management tools for AI assistants.
IzumiSy/mcp-duckdb-memory-server
MCP Memory Server with DuckDB backend
alexander-zuev/supabase-mcp-server
Query MCP enables end-to-end management of Supabase via chat interface: read & write query...
wenb1n-dev/mysql_mcp_server_pro
Model Context Protocol (MCP) server that supports secure interaction with MySQL databases and...